What to check before for high-rise buildings near the B65 bus in NYC
- Start by shortlisting buildings that match your commute needs along the B65 route, then filter again by the building’s high-rise criteria.
- Before applying, verify the unit details: lease term, net effective rent, and any move-in costs (deposits, fees, and required paperwork).
- For high-rises, confirm building amenities and policies in writing, including package handling, elevator access, laundry, and any parking or storage terms.
- Check the specifics behind any building signals you see on Openigloo (what’s reported vs. what the current policy is), and ask management what changed recently.
- If you’re comparing multiple buildings, plan a direct comparison of total monthly cost, not just asking rent.
